Heather T Forbes, LCSW, Adoptive Mom, Parenting ExpertHeather T. Forbes, LCSW has trained in the field of trauma and attachment with nationally recognized, first-generation attachment therapists since 1999. Co-author of "Beyond Consequences, Logic, and Control: A Love-based Approach for Helping Children With Severe Behaviors Vol. 1", author of Vol 2 as well as the new "Dare To Love", Heather lectures, consults, and coaches parents and professionals throughout the U.S., Canada, and the U.K.

Much of her experience and insight on understanding trauma, disruptive behaviors, and adoption related issues has come from her most important job, being the mother of her two children (both adopted as toddlers from Russia and both of whom had intense traumatic histories).

Live, Interactive Classes for Caregivers of Children with Difficult Behaviors now available Online for Adoption, Foster or Court Requirement and Personal / Professional Growth

Live, Interactive Classes for Caregivers of Children with Difficult Behaviors now available Online for Adoption, Foster or Court Requirement and Personal / Professional Growth

Heather T. Forbes, LCSW of the Beyond Consequences Institute (BCI), offers parents and professionals a new and exciting interactive online program, available at www.beyondconsequencesonline.com.

This unique 11 week program offers live, interactive courses in a virtual classroom environment for both parents and professionals. The course is based on the book authored by Forbes, “Beyond Consequences, Logic & Control; A Love-Based Approach to Helping Children with Severe Behaviors” which is frequently a #1 Amazon.com Bestseller in the Adoption Category. This course is ideal for those needing to take a parenting class for adoption and foster parent training, at the request of the court, as part of a legal or probationary requirement, a custody agreement, or simply for personal growth as a parent or professional.

“Parents can take advantage of the technology we use to get connected and supported in ways they’ve never been able to before.” says Forbes, “We have designed an online experience like no other. The Beyond Consequences Online professional and parenting training program can be taken from anywhere in the world and can be attended live or through the recordings.”
